iRobot Roomba J7+
The iRobot Roomba J7+ is an upgrade over the previous model by the company and includes a new feature to make it more effective in avoiding pet waste. It uses intelligent navigation and mapping to create maps of floors and rooms and tries to avoid obstacles like charging cords, furniture and shoes. It also can detect dirt, and prioritise areas of cleaning that are particularly dirty. This is a significant improvement over earlier models that often ignored dirtiest spots or only cleaned them for an insignificant amount of time.
The robot vacuum comes with a brand new self-emptying base station that will dump dust from the bin into its own 2.4L dirt disposal bag. iRobot claims that the bag can store debris for up to 60 days, so you only have to empty it and replace it every three months. The base station can also hold an extra bag for quick replacements.
The Roomba is simple to set-up and use. It is compatible with Alexa and Google Assistant, and can be controlled using the iRobot Genius App. Utilizing the app, you can choose to begin and stop cleaning, set the duration it should be working on each job, and set up a schedule.
In our tests during our tests, the iRobot Roomba J7+ was able to clean the floors of area rug and hardwood without any problems in the foyer, kitchen and family room. It listened to our commands and did its jobs quietly, registering just 64 decibels on the decibel meter when it was in operation. It took it 90 minutes to clean a single space, and the battery needed to be recharged following the cleaning for an hour and 58 minute. You can also grow your iRobot ecosystem with the Combo J7, which lets you to connect it with the iRobot mop m6 to have one run while the other one moves around the room.
Dyson 360 Viz Nav
The Dyson 360 Viz Nav is the best robot vacuum cleaner for those who live in a multi-floor house. This model can make maps of different floors and store them on the app, making it easy to switch between different spaces without repeating the setup procedure. The robot can be controlled using voice commands, including Amazon Alexa and Google Assistant.
Dyson has taken a different approach to obstacle detection than most other robots, employing sensors and cameras. A panoramic camera that is mounted on top of the robot, along with 26 sensors external, creates an image of the area as it moves. This allows the robot to avoid obstacles and furniture.
In our tests during our tests, the Dyson 360 Vis Nav was capable of reaching right up to the edges and baseboards, and could also be easily guided around pieces of furniture with very tight corners. The robot's suction was strong and was able to capture every speck of dust hair, strand of hair, and dried-out bit of Playdoh that we threw at it. The vacuum was able to empty the bin quickly and efficiently, cutting down on the time spent cleaning by half.
However the Dyson 360 Viz Nav didn't perform better than other robots in our obstacle-avoidance test. It had a tough time with a temporary drying rack that it repeatedly tried to move under, but ended up getting stuck and disrupting the cleaning process. It also had difficulty navigating some taller pieces of furniture such as the coffee table or a chair. The Dyson 360 Vis Nav also has difficulty climbing stairs which is a concern for many people who live in multi-story houses.
Roborock
Roborock robot vacuums come with high-end features that make them stand out from the crowd. They have dual mops that spin while pressing down, and then effortlessly lift the stains. They also automatically lift carpets when vacuuming to avoid leaving dirty streaks and cleaning the vacuum of dirt. They have a suction of up to 5,500 Pa, which is superior in the removal of dirt and dust. They also have smart water flow controls to ensure the right amount of moisture is applied to every floor type.
One of the most impressive aspects about Roborock is its ability to map out your complete home layout using laser technology. The LiDAR system on the Roborock robot constantly rotates, emitting laser beams and calculating the amount of time it takes them to bounce back off the objects around them. This information is then used to construct an accurate map of your home's layout which allows it to navigate with a high degree of accuracy and avoid obstacles.
Based on the model you select, you can customize the map to include furniture placements, no-go zones and specific cleaning for your room. You can also select a cleaning schedule for vacuum only, mop by itself, or vacuum+mop. You can schedule regular cleanings by using an app-based cleaning system that lets you to set it and forget it.
Roborock provides a range of options, ranging from the budget-friendly S6 MaxV to the top-of the-line S7 MaxV. All models have advanced mapping, a long-lasting battery, and a huge dustbin. Beko RCV 5
The Beko RCV 5 may be an relative newcomer to the robotic vacuum and mopping industry however its sleek design and reasonable cost have already made it a cult. The Beko RCV 5 has a few tricks in its sleeves that make it stand out from the rest, such as self-emptying capabilities and object recognition. It's also simple to install and use, using a simple app that allows you to alter the settings to suit your preferences.
The model's navigation system makes use of sensors and mapping to help you navigate your home. It does a good job of staying clear of obstacles. You can also alter the cleaning route using the app, making it simple to clean certain areas more frequently than others. The app may be confusing at first but once you learn how to use it, you will be able to schedule cleanings and control the robot's power levels.
The RCV 5 has some flaws despite its impressive list. It has an extremely small water tank that holds up to 240ml of water at each time. This is sufficient for a basic wipe-clean, but not ideal for stubborn stains. Additionally, the wiping plate is rather simplistic and doesn't include the ability to rotate or vibrate.
The battery life of a robot at this price isn't as long as one might imagine. The battery of the RCV 5 only lasts for about a third cleaning cycle. It's not a huge issue, but is something to be aware of when searching for the latest robotic vacuum cleaner.
Karcher RCV 5
The German manufacturer Karcher is most famous for its pressure washers, but it has entered the market of robot vacuums with a model that vacuums and mops. The RCV 5 offers an impressive variety of features, including great obstacle detection (with a dual laser system) and mapping that can be tracked in real-time via the smart app.
It can also detect carpeted surfaces and then automatically activate the wet mopping feature. It also has a spot cleaning feature that cleans a specific area of around 3 feet. It's also scheduled for weekly repetition. The RCV 5 is a great robot cleaner that has suction power of 2500 pascals. It is able to clean both hard and soft flooring, and can reach into corners and even under furniture that is low.
Karcher Home Robots is an app that runs on smartphones, as with other robots it can be used to begin cleaning processes and make maps of your home. The RCV 5 also has the ability to create virtual walls and zones that it cannot drive.
The RCV 5 has a downside in that its dust bin is only a litre, and will need to be emptied regularly. This is unlike other models that incorporate disposal technology in their docking station. It's also heavier than many of its competitors, making it less mobile, and thus requiring more space in the charging station. Nonetheless, testers found the RCV 5 very user-friendly and rated its app control high. It performed well on our tests, although some struggled to get the voice technology to function well and found the docking station difficult to put in an upright position.
